Hasini rape and murder case: Accused Dashwanth remanded to judicial custody

CHENNAI: A 22-year old man, nabbed from Mumbai on the charge of killing his mother recently and raping and murdering a seven year old girl early this year, was brought here and remanded to judicial custody today.

Dashwanth was produced before a magistrate who remanded him to judicial custody. He was later lodged in the Puzhal Central Prison, police said.

A Tamil Nadu police special team brought the accused here from Mumbai last night.

He was arrested on December 6 in Mumbai but escaped from police custody the very next day.

Dashwant was nabbed again in a joint operation with the Maharashtra police on December 8.

He was first arrested in February this year for the alleged rape and murder of a seven year old girl and granted bail in September.

On December 2, he allegedly killed his mother Sarala and escaped with her jewellery.
